Lyttle says more support needs to be given to parents

Alliance MLA Chris Lyttle has said more support needs to be given to parents after a report showed the cost of childcare here continues to rise.

East Belfast MLA Mr Lyttle was speaking after helping launch a new report by charity Employers for Childcare at Stormont, which showed a full-time place now costs £8,528 per year.

Of the 5,000 local parents who took part in a survey for the report, 56 per cent were under increased financial pressure due to the childcare bill and 24 per cent were forced to rely on other means to regularly meet their childcare payments.

“The findings of this report are worrying,” said Mr Lyttle.

“Clearly the cost of childcare has increased higher than the rate of inflation, which is difficult for many parents to cope with. Ensuring parents have access to affordable, professional and qualified childcare is vital if we are to make it easier for them to remain in employment.

“The Executive’s draft childcare strategy, which is currently out to consultation, needs to ensure long-term planning takes place so all parents and guardians can access the best possible childcare in an affordable manner.”
